| Landover, MD (BettingExpress) - Alex Smith threw for 200 yards and a touchdown and Frank Gore ran for 107 yards, as the San Francisco 49ers earned a 19-11 victory over the Washington Redskins. Gore became the first player in San Francisco franchise history to record five consecutive 100-yard rushing performances and David Akers hit four field goals for the 49ers (7-1), who have won six straight for the first time since winning 11 in a row back in 1997. | to the sidelines due to a recurrence of a neck injury suffered in the preseason. Buchanon had to serve a four-game suspension at the outset of the year because of a violation of the NFL's policy regarding performance-enhancing drugs. In 2010, the Miami-Florida product recorded 49 tackles, two interceptions and two forces fumbles in 16 games for the Redskins. Washington promoted cornerback Brandyn Thompson from the practice squad. The Redskins host the top team in the NFC West, the San Francisco 49ers, on Sunday. |

| New York, NY (BettingExpress) - Cincinnati Bengals quarterback Andy Dalton and San Francisco 49ers linebacker Aldon Smith have been selected as the NFL's top rookie for the month of October. Dalton helped the surprising Bengals to a 4-0 mark during October, completing 63.1 percent of his passes for 909 yards with six touchdowns to earn the offensive award.
